08 2019 档案

摘要:BSGS BSGS(Baby Step Giant Step),中文名大步小步算法,也有拔山盖世、北上广深、阿姆斯特朗算法等别称 解决问题为求AxB(mod C)的最小整数解,其中A C互质。 首先因为ϕ(C)一个循环节且$\phi(C) include i 阅读全文
posted @ 2019-08-18 19:26 __Liuz 阅读(363) 评论(0) 推荐(0) 编辑
摘要:Crt 求解不定方程组 设M=inmi Mi=Mmi=k,kinmk tiMi在模mi时的逆元 先上结论 通解为$\sum\limits_i^na_iM_it_i mod  阅读全文
posted @ 2019-08-18 18:34 __Liuz 阅读(98) 评论(0) 推荐(0) 编辑
摘要:扩展欧拉定理 当gcd(a,m)=1时就是欧拉定理 后面两种情况对gcd无要求,注意cϕ(m)的关系 Description2222(mod p) 简化为求x2x (modp)) Solution 因为 阅读全文
posted @ 2019-08-18 10:20 __Liuz 阅读(116) 评论(0) 推荐(0) 编辑
摘要:Description 给你一张n×m的网格图及每条边边权,有q组询问,每次询问两点间的最短距离。 Solution 暴力做法是枚举所有询问点跑最短路,复杂度O(qnlogn),由于q很大,过不了这个题 考虑分治,每次找到一条分界线,如果询问两点都在左边或者都在右 阅读全文
posted @ 2019-08-14 17:07 __Liuz 阅读(160) 评论(0) 推荐(0) 编辑
摘要:前言 当我做另一道题使用最短路算法时,我习惯性地去Luogu博找Dijksttra的板子,这时候我觉得这种算法应该记住,于是我又重温了一遍最短路算法,发现了很多困惑,尤其是关于SPFADijkstra算法的区别。因为我的SPFADijkstra都使用了堆优化。 然后我困惑 阅读全文
posted @ 2019-08-06 15:54 __Liuz 阅读(138) 评论(0) 推荐(0) 编辑
摘要:一道水题,我也不知道为什么要写博客,这应该是最后一次了 Description 给你n个节点的树,要求你在上面选取一个联通块,使得点权和最大 Soution 树形DP,我们实际上是在求一颗子树,用dp[i]表示以i为根的子树能得到的最大值即可 转移方程显然:$DP[i]=a[ 阅读全文
posted @ 2019-08-01 18:55 __Liuz 阅读(126) 评论(0) 推荐(0) 编辑
摘要:题目描述 有一个ab的整数组成的矩阵,现请你从中找出一个nn的正方形区域,使得该区域所有数中的最大值和最小值的差最小。 输入输出格式 输入格式: 第一行为3个整数,分别表示a,b,n的值 第二行至第a+1行每行为b个非负整数,表示矩阵中相应位置上的数。每行相邻两数之间用一 阅读全文
posted @ 2019-08-01 09:30 __Liuz 阅读(119)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示